Specialized Cleaning Tools

The Shark Performance Powered Lift-Away comes with a more extensive set of specialized cleaning tools, including a Pet Crevice Tool, Wide Upholstery Tool, and a HairPro Self-Cleaning Pet Power Brush. This expanded toolkit is beneficial for tackling various cleaning challenges throughout the home. In contrast, the Shark LA702 includes a Crevice Tool, Upholstery Tool, and Anti-Allergen Dust Brush, which, while effective, may not cover as many scenarios as the Performance model's toolkit. If versatility in cleaning tools is a priority, the Performance model stands out.
